Olo is a leading SaaS platform accelerating digital transformation in the restaurant industry by helping customers deliver more personalized and profitable guest experiences. As a result, our digital ordering, payment, and guest engagement solutions enable brands to do more with less and make every guest feel like a regular.

As a Product Manager at Olo, you'll be on a mission to help our restaurant brands efficiently grow their digital business. In this role, you'll develop, own, and execute the roadmap for a high-impact product suite in partnership with our customers, Engineers, Designers, and cross-functional stakeholders. You'll ensure that we solve the right customer problems at the right time in ways that our customers love and that drive our business forward. Your relentless focus on measuring impact will ensure that we continuously deliver value to our customers while expanding our position as the best-in-breed provider in our space.

You can work remotely from anywhere in the U.S. or at Olo's headquarters in NYC.

What You'll Do

  • Establish and maintain a deep understanding of your product, customers, user personas, and their respective pain points to drive product development.
  • Independently develop and refresh the long-term vision and strategy for your product, ensuring alignment with leadership on strategic objectives and economic viability.
  • Build and maintain an outcome-focused product roadmap leveraging customer insights, data analysis, business objectives, stakeholder input, and market research.
  • Proactively seek opportunities to improve business processes, product development methodologies, and team workflows, demonstrating initiative and commitment to continuous improvement.
  • Lead the discovery and implementation of innovative solutions to customer challenges through ideation, prototype development, testing (user and A / B), and analysis.
  • Frequently leverage data analytics and insights to inform decision-making and drive product improvements and optimizations.
  • Collaborate with Design and Engineering to translate requirements into functional specifications, ensuring a balance between technical and customer-centric priorities.
  • Develop and foster direct, ongoing relationships with customers to gain unencumbered access to insights and drive solution adoption.
  • Identify and present opportunities to invest in and monetize solutions for customer problems, developing coherent business cases for executive alignment.
  • Provide frequent stakeholder updates on product development progress, ensuring regular feedback is sought and addressed to drive continuous improvement.

What We'll Expect From You

  • 5 years experience in Product Management at a software company
  • Bachelor's Degree or higher from an accredited institution anywhere in the world
  • Ideal candidates have experience scaling an API-first partner ecosystem product
  • Able to proactively manage your workload and tasks independently, demonstrating good judgment in prioritization and time management
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. Your statements and questions are succinct and direct.
  • Able to travel to customer, partner, conference, and Olo office locations as needed
  • About Olo

    Olo (NYSE : OLO) is a leading restaurant technology provider with ordering, payment, and guest engagement solutions that help brands increase orders, streamline operations, and improve the guest experience. Each day, Olo processes millions of orders on its open SaaS platform, gathering the right data from each touchpoint into a single source-so restaurants can better understand and better serve every guest on every channel, every time. Over 700 restaurant brands trust Olo and its network of more than 400 integration partners to innovate on behalf of the restaurant community, accelerating technology's positive impact and creating a world where every restaurant guest feels like a regular.
